On Monday, the Guardian published a correction to its already scathing review of first lady Melania Trump’s new Amazon-backed doc — and it’s pretty humiliating.

“The star rating for this film was corrected on 2 February 2026,” the correction begins. “A formatting issue led an earlier version to be awarded one star, when the reviewer’s intention was zero.”

Although most critics have panned the film directed by Brett Ratner — who was accused in 2017 of sexual harassment or misconduct by at least six women — Guardian contributor Xan Brooks’ review is particularly brutal.

In the review, which was originally published Friday, Brooks seems to have a lot of fun comparing Trump to some pretty unflattering figures like the kid-eating witch in “Hansel and Gretel” and Adolf Hitler’s longtime girlfriend and brief wife, Eva Braun.
